# Heads up: the Payflo integration tests are flaky because the sandbox
# ledger service at Quartzline occasionally cold-starts and times out the
# first request. Don't burn an afternoon on it like I did — just retry once
# before declaring failure. The client below needs auth against the internal
# sandbox ledger, and the key it expects is this one:

app token of badug-tahaf = qvz11-nP5FBNr8qnh

When a proctor account is locked mid-session, candidates remain queued but unassigned. First, verify the lockout in the Vigilquiz admin panel and confirm the queue depth has not exceeded fifty. Reassign pending sessions to the standby proctor pool, then initiate recovery from the operations console. The console requires dual confirmation: the reviewer approves the change, and the operator authenticates. Once the reviewer has approved, the operator enters the recovery passphrase given below.

unlock words, yawig-kagef: gordor-holvan-ulaael-pramir-ulaiel-tamdor

Leadership Review Briefing — For the Incoming Director
Kestrel Foods intends to enter the Varenholm region in the coming fiscal year. Market analysis by the Delaquist team shows steady demand and limited local competition beyond two regional distributors. A leased facility near Port Anselm has been shortlisted. Initial headcount is projected at eighteen, with logistics contracted to Harrowby Freight. Capital requirements are within the approved envelope. The confidential business plan summary appears below.

internal memo for bahap-yagug: Headcount on the Ulaix team goes from 3 to 100 by the end of January. Gross margin on Ulaix came in at 10 percent against a plan of 15 percent.

# Break-Glass: Catalog Cache Invalidation

Scope: the Pinrow product catalog at Veldstone Retail. If stale prices persist after a purge and the Hollowmere invalidation queue is wedged, use break-glass to flush the edge tier directly. Contractors: get verbal sign-off from the catalog lead first. Steps: open the Hollowmere admin shell, select emergency-flush, confirm the tenant, and run it once — repeated flushes thrash the origin. Access is logged and expires after 20 minutes. Unseal the admin shell with the passphrase below.

recovery phrase for kahop-tajog: istix-casvan